Consumer Reports
/kənˌsjuːmə rɪˈpɔːts/
/kənˌsuːmər rɪˈpɔːrts/
- a US magazine, published each month since 1936, which tests products and writes about their quality and value. It is published by the independent Consumers Union that does not make a profit. There are no advertisements in the magazine. Information is also available on the Consumer Reports website. compare Which?
